Your Role

As our Dental Patient Coordinator, you'll be the first impression for our practices while helping ensure every patient receives a seamless, personalized experience from their first phone call through completion of treatment.

Primary Responsibilities
  • Welcome patients and create a warm, professional first impression
  • Answer phones, schedule appointments, and manage provider schedules efficiently
  • Check patients in and out while ensuring accurate demographic and insurance information
  • Verify insurance benefits and explain coverage to patients
  • Present treatment plans and review financial arrangements with confidence and compassion
  • Coordinate patient financing and collect payments
  • Process insurance claims, payments, and outstanding balances
  • Maintain accurate electronic patient records and documentation
  • Coordinate referrals and communication between general dentistry and the periodontal specialty office
  • Monitor appointment schedules to maximize efficiency and patient flow
  • Help maintain patient retention through follow-up appointments and outstanding treatment scheduling
  • Respond to patient questions and resolve concerns with professionalism and empathy
  • Support the clinical team with administrative tasks that contribute to an exceptional patient experience

Working Conditions

This position is primarily administrative and includes sitting, standing, frequent patient interaction, computer work, and occasional lifting of office supplies up to 35 pounds. The role requires excellent communication skills, attention to detail, and the ability to multitask in a busy dental environment.
